Have thought of adapting this mantra, "Just say it" .. Few articles (ok just two of them)moved me to adapt this. What's it all about do read on !
There were two articles One was by an NRI who dreads the emergency calls usually expected from old parents who would get hospitalized or get ill suddenly and the feeling that you never expressed what you felt for them because you were so busy chasing your dreams hits you hard & the other where a lady - wife - mother got killed in an accident at Santacruz driving back after dropping her husband at the airport! The latter sent me on a spin of thoughts on what must have been her last words to her husband before he boarded the plane ? How many kids did she have ? How would they cope without her ? Was there anyone at home along with her kids ?

As a person i usually express my thoughts - good,bad as well as neutral ones. But when i compare all the three its "bad" that leads the pack hence i thought before its too late let me thank and express what each person in my life is special and i am what i am because they have a made a difference to my life
